## How Do You Choose the Right Workforce Planning Software?

### What You Should Know About Workforce Planning Software

### Workforce planning software buying insights at a glance

[Workforce planning software](https://www.g2.com/categories/workforce-planning) helps organizations **forecast staffing needs, align hiring plans with budgets, and maintain visibility into workforce costs** as teams grow. These platforms allow HR, finance, and operations leaders to model headcount changes, evaluate compensation impact, and track organizational structure in a centralized system rather than managing workforce decisions across disconnected spreadsheets.

Across G2 reviews, buyers often describe workforce planning systems as tools that bring structure to hiring requests, role approvals, and staffing forecasts. Instead of reconciling multiple documents or email threads, teams use these solutions to manage workforce planning workflows in one place and maintain clearer alignment between hiring plans and business priorities.&amp;nbsp;

As organizations scale, these tools also help leadership teams understand how workforce changes affect budgets, reporting structures, and long-term staffing strategies.

Pricing for workforce planning solutions typically varies based on implementation scope, number of users, integration requirements, and whether the software is part of a broader [HR](https://www.g2.com/categories/hr) or [financial planning platform](https://www.g2.com/categories/fp-a-financial-planning-analysis).

### My Expert Takeaway on Workforce Planning Software in 2026

While reviewing the feedback across this dataset, I noticed that many organizations adopt workforce planning software after their hiring processes become too complex to manage in spreadsheets. Reviewers say these platforms help track open roles, plan staffing, and understand workforce costs clearly.

Another pattern I saw in the reviews is how often these tools sit at the intersection of HR and financial planning. Teams regularly mention connecting these platforms with HRIS tools, [payroll systems](https://www.g2.com/categories/payroll), and financial planning software so leadership can evaluate hiring decisions alongside budget impact. When workforce planning tools are integrated into these systems, they tend to become a central reference point for staffing discussions rather than just a reporting layer.

Industry distribution in the dataset suggests that adoption is especially strong in technology and IT services companies, where rapid hiring cycles make structured planning more important. At the same time, reviewers from healthcare, insurance, and other regulated industries emphasize the value of workforce planning solutions for managing staffing levels, maintaining compliance requirements, and ensuring operational continuity.

One recurring challenge in the reviews is the complexity of implementation when organizations move from informal planning methods to a structured system. Several reviewers note that setting up approval paths, reporting views, and workforce planning models requires careful planning. From what I observed in the feedback, teams that establish these processes early tend to adopt the software more smoothly.&amp;nbsp;

Once those foundations are in place, the best workforce planning software supports more informed hiring decisions and better alignment between staffing plans and business growth.
